Output d62c69f9703744f21e4a329aa26a11c0c98dc36526bbcd959874667a16ed6f13:14

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ab33e7ab5cb2b4366f89ac741f86e34e051b924f OP_EQUAL
address
A83WPcUermpuTEj11ZnK4EPP2sYpTW5aDY
transaction
d62c69f9703744f21e4a329aa26a11c0c98dc36526bbcd959874667a16ed6f13